Hunter Biden, the son of the president of the United States, Joe Biden, withdrew this Wednesday the guilty plea for tax crimes that he had agreed with the prosecutors since he was not guaranteed that he could get rid of all the charges against him.

The president’s son decided to declare himself not guilty after the judge in charge of the case questioned the validity of the agreement by which she acknowledged not having declared the income of 2017 and 2018 to the Treasury, because said agreement included escape prosecution on another chargethat of possession of a firearm -which is illegal when it comes to a person with addictions-.

The hearing held in a Wilmington federal court this Wednesday ended no final agreement and with Biden changing his statement after a session full of interruptions and position changes.

Biden went to court in Wilmington, Delaware, to plead guilty to two minor tax offenses for not having declared to the Treasury the income he obtained in 2017 and 2018 and the prosecutors, for their part, complied with the agreement and requested probation for him.

The pact included the resignation of the Prosecutor’s Office to prosecute Biden for another case in which he is also accused, that of possessing a firearm despite having addiction problems, which could carry a sentence of several years in prison.
